Roadtrip Shenanigans Part 3!
Guess who still had too many headcanons to put in that second post? Me and @garrulousgibberish​ that’s who! I think this might just be a singalong post haha! If so - there’s still more headcanons to come!
- Singing. FAMILY SING SONGS. You can’t convince me otherwise what with sea shanties and harmonicas and all the other good happy music that we’ve thrown at the Pines family. (We just want them happy and excited and- shhh). OK so as per Ran’s amazing drawing above. Stan and Ford will sing sea shanties all day long if you let them, as if they’re still walking through a small fishing town and joining in the raucous there. Usually one of them will start and the other will end up tapping along with it as they drive but it doesn’t take long before they’re belting it out together. This might be very deliberate - Ford’s found that humming to himself is one way to stop Stan being distracting or distracted while driving. Or it might be Stan who’s trying to see how long it’ll take for Ford to cave when he’s trying to do something important.
It takes a while for the kids to join in on a few of them, unless they’re ones the Stan’s have already taught them, then they’re clamoring about to sing along. It’s probably similar when the kids start singing a song that the older pair aren’t familiar with and it takes a while for them to catch the lyrics enough to join in. (Depending how much they like the tune and how quickly though they’ll probably end up humming along anyway and if it’s catchy get irritated that only a portion is stuck in their head on repeat for awhile).
Other times it’s not all of them singing though. After all Stan is horrified when Dipper and Ford get hooked on a new pop song together, one of the ones on the radio so many times when it first comes out you’re sick of it within a few days. Unless you’re Ford and Dipper - then you just sing along every time it comes on. Every. Time.  Mabel is delighted- Stan not so much.
Mabel and Stan are a force to be reckoned with when they sing. Usually their singalongs start from accidental song lyrics in conversations. ”How far are we from the next stop, sweetie?” ”Uhm... Looks like we’re halfway there.” ”Ohh~ Living on a prayer~” Usually their singalongs are dramatic renditions. ”Take my hand and we’ll make it I swear~” ”Stan! Hands on the wheel!!!” They just have to make sure Ford doesn’t catch them if they’re meant to be doing something important.
There are times when there aren’t singalongs though. When the family just sits and listens to one family member who probably hasn’t even noticed that no ones joining in - too engrossed in the song. With Ford it’s songs from the other side of the portal. Maybe a song on the radio reminds him, a familiar tune or hum that morphs into a completely different song that he doesn’t even realise never came out in this dimension. It’s usually while he’s doing something, not really paying attention and the words just bubble out, lyrics that stuck with him, or songs that were big and hold good memories when he heard them - different times when he’d finally been able to stop and relax even if only for a little while. The others just sit and listen. If Ford only knew that the quietest the family got were when they were listening to him like this. Maybe then he’d know how to distract them more effectively but that wasn’t the point. The point was that the others liked it when he was doing it just for himself. It was nice to hear about something from the other side and know from Ford’s wistful happy smile that a good memory accompanied it for once.
Then there’s Stan. He doesn’t sing all that often on his own but sometimes an old song will come on the radio or he’ll hear a lyric in someone else’s voice and out roars an old rock classic that refused to stay down. Songs that he would have heard on the radio years and years ago when he just had his car and the open road ahead of him. He probably associates a few of the songs with some daredevil escapes - him and that car have lived quite the life together. If it’s a song on the radio and Stan knows all the words instantly the others pause to grin, it’s rare that Stan get’s so into a song that he belts it out without a care. Or at least rare against the rest of them. The first time it happened was probably the most shocking for them! Only problem is the times when Stan sings lyrics because of them. Because he forgets that Ford wouldn’t know the songs all that well, if at all, if they came out after he fell through the portal and the kids sometimes only really know the choruses if that. He’s sometimes lucky if they’re on Mabel’s karaoke machine but other times he is affronted that his family do not know the songs. Though Mabel does love how his eyes light up if at first they don’t know the verses but join in on the chorus when they do recognise the song.  But it still gets to him and he finds a radio station that only plays older songs and spends the day ‘teaching’ them songs he thinks they should just know. Every song that comes on he seems to know all the lyrics to though so every song is important and must be taught. (Ford doesn’t tire of the way Stan beams as every song starts with a ‘Oh! I love this one!’) Sometimes they’ll just pretend not to know though - just because it’s so fun watching Stan getting really into the song and forgetting that anyone else is around him.
In the same vein though - once or twice whilst he’s teaching, an even older song will come on the radio. One both older twins know and gets them all nostalgic and singing along. The kinds of songs their Ma used to like listening to and would be heard throughout the house when they were kids. And when the kids sit bemused and kind of swaying along there is a consensus between Stan and Ford that nope you guys need to know one of Ma’s favourites. Can’t have that.
